所选语种没有对应资源,请选择:

本站点使用Cookies,继续浏览表示您同意我们使用Cookies。Cookies和隐私政策>

提示

尊敬的用户,您的IE浏览器版本过低,为获取更好的浏览体验,请升级您的IE浏览器。

升级

CloudEngine 8800, 7800, 6800, 5800 V200R005C10 配置指南-网络管理与监控

本文档介绍了网络管理与监控的配置,具体包括SNMP配置、RMON配置、NETCONF配置、OpenFlow Agent配置、LLDP配置、NQA配置、镜像配置、报文捕获配置、Packet trace、路径/连通性探测配置、NetStream配置、sFlow配置和iPCA配置。

评分并提供意见反馈 :
华为采用机器翻译与人工审校相结合的方式将此文档翻译成不同语言,希望能帮助您更容易理解此文档的内容。 请注意:即使是最好的机器翻译,其准确度也不及专业翻译人员的水平。 华为对于翻译的准确性不承担任何责任,并建议您参考英文文档(已提供链接)。
<edit-config>编辑配置数据

<edit-config>编辑配置数据

<edit-config>操作用来把全部或部分配置数据加载到指定的目标配置数据库(<running/>或<candidate/>)。设备对<edit-config>中的操作进行鉴权,鉴权通过后,执行相应的修改。

<edit-config>操作支持多种加载配置方式,例如:支持加载本地文件、远程文件,支持在线编辑。如果NETCONF服务器支持URL能力,可以使用标识本地配置文件的<url>参数替代<config>参数。

<edit-config>操作RPC报文中各参数含义如下:
  • <config>:一组由数据模型定义的层次化的配置数据。

    <config>中可能包含可选的“operation”属性,用来给配置数据指定操作类型。如果未携带“operation”属性,则默认为merge操作。Operation取值如下:
    • merge:在数据库中修改存在或不存在的目标数据,如果目标数据不存在则创建,如果目标数据存在则修改。这是默认操作。
    • create:当且仅当配置数据库中不存在待创建的配置数据时,才能成功添加到配置数据库。如果配置数据存在,则会返回<rpc-error>,其中包含一个<error-tag>值“data-exists”。
    • delete:删除配置数据库中指定的配置数据记录。如果数据存在,则删除该数据,如果数据不存在,则返回<rpc-error>,其中包含一个<error-tag>值“data-missing”。
    • remove:删除配置数据库中指定的配置数据记录。如果数据存在,则删除该数据,如果数据不存在,则返回成功。
  • target:待编辑的配置数据库。基于场景选择对应的数据库:

    • 立即生效模式,配置数据库为<running/>。

    • 两阶段生效模式,配置数据库为<candidate/>,对该数据库操作后需执行<commit>操作提交配置,修改后的配置才能生效。

    • 试运行,配置数据库设置为<candidate/>。

  • default-operation:为<edit-config>操作设置默认操作。

    default-operation参数是可选的,缺省值为“merge”,取值如下:

    • merge:<config>参数中的配置数据与目标配置数据库中的配置合并。这是默认操作。

    • none:除了执行operation属性指定的操作外,目标配置数据库中的配置数据不受<config>中其他配置数据影响。如果<config>参数中含有目标配置数据库中对应的数据层次上不存在的配置数据,则返回<rpc-error>,<error-tag>值为“data-missing”,这样可以避免在执行指定操作时,无意中创建了冗余的元素。比如执行删除指定子元素操作时,<config>中包含该子元素的父层次结构,而目标数据库中不包含其父元素的配置,此时如果default-operation参数取值为非none的其他操作类型,则在删除该子元素的同时也会在目的数据库中创建其父元素的配置,如果default-operation参数取值为none,则只会删除该子元素,而不会创建其父元素的配置。

  • error-option:<error-option>用于设置一个实例配置出错后,后续实例配置的处理方式,缺省值为stop-on-error,取值为:

    • stop-on-error:出现错误后停止操作。
    • continue-on-error:出现错误后记录错误信息并继续执行,只要发生错误,NETCONF服务器会给客户端返回一个操作失败的<rpc-reply>消息。
    • rollback-on-error:出现错误后停止操作,并将配置回退到执行<edit-config>操作之前的状态。只有设备支持rollback-on-error能力才支持此操作。
Validate能力支持的前提下,<edit-config>操作支持携带test-option参数,如果<edit-config>操作没有携带此参数,系统默认按照test-then-set流程处理。
  • 当test-option参数取值为test-then-set或者不带参数时,任一层次的节点都支持delete和remove操作,删除配置数据库中指定节点下的所有配置数据。

翻译
下载文档
更新时间:2020-01-09

文档编号:EDOC1100075464

浏览量:13106

下载量:225

平均得分:
本文档适用于这些产品

相关版本

相关文档

Share
上一页 下一页